Latest Patents

Madison holds a patent for the invention titled "AllnAsSb avalanche photodiode and related method thereof." This patent describes an avalanche photodiode that includes a first contact layer, a multiplication layer made of AlInAsSb, a charge layer also comprising AlInAsSb, an absorption layer of AlInAsSb, a blocking layer, and a second contact layer.
